Linux实战笔记_CentOS7_yum相关配置

配置yum源优先级

配置优先级

yum -y install yum-plugin-priorities.noarch
vi /etc/yum.repos.d/localISO.repo
priority=1 #添加一行即可

启用/禁用优先级

cat /etc/yum/pluginconf.d/priorities.conf
[main]
enabled=1 #1为启用,0为禁用

挂载光驱为yum源

cat /etc/cdrom #将系统光盘插入光驱并使用此命令检查是否插入
mkdir /mnt/cdrom #创建要挂载的文件夹
vi /etc/fstab #设置开机自动挂载
#添加一行
/dev/cdrom /mnt/cdrom iso9660 defaults
cd /etc #进入/etc目录
cp -r yum.repo.d/ yum.repo.d.save #备份原有yum.repo.d/文件夹
cd yum.repo.d/ #进入yum.repo.d/文件夹
rm -rf * #删除所有repo文件
vi localiso.repo #新建repo文件
#添加下列文本
[localISO]
name=This is a localISO Server
baseurl=file:///mnt/cdrom
enabled=1
gpgcheck=0
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7
#开始挂载
mount -a
#刷新yum源
yum clean all
yum makecache
yum repolist

 本地.iso镜像为yum源

#挂载目录
mkdir /mnt/b
mount /root/Centos7.iso /mnt/b -o loop
#新建本地yum源配置文件
touch /etc/yum.repo.d/localISO.repo
vi /etc/yum.repo.d/localISO.repo
#添加下列文本
[localISO]
name=This is a localISO Server
baseurl=file:///mnt/b
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-CentOS-7
#刷新yum源
yum clean all
yum makecache
yum repolist

搭建FTP服务器作为yum源

(略)有空再说吧!

搭建WEB服务器作为yum源

(略)有空再说吧!

使用网络yum源(163、aliyun)

拷贝网络yum源配置文件(例如CentOS7-Base-163.repo)到/etc/yum.repos.d/中,刷新yum源即可。

Centos7下载地址:https://mirrors.163.com/.help/centos.html            #貌似已失效?

Centos8下载地址:http://mirrors.aliyun.com/repo/Centos-8.repo

 

posted @   dustfree  阅读(59)  评论(0编辑  收藏  举报
相关博文:
阅读排行:
· 无需6万激活码!GitHub神秘组织3小时极速复刻Manus,手把手教你使用OpenManus搭建本
· Manus爆火,是硬核还是营销?
· 终于写完轮子一部分:tcp代理 了,记录一下
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 单元测试从入门到精通
点击右上角即可分享
微信分享提示